Have you used dryer balls?

tinam61
7 years ago

One of our local news stations has a feature on the early morning weekday news - a guy who shares good buys/bargains. Hubs was apparently listening to him one day last week and later asked me about "dryer balls". The ones advertised were woolzies brand. They told you could reduce drying time,etc. I later looked them up and ordered a set from Jet. I've used them in 3 or 4 loads of laundry. I am interested to see if they will cut static electricity (usually only a problem in cold weather). Clothes definitely come out of the dryer with less wrinkles. I'm not sure if loads dry in less time because I don't used timed cycles. I do think the load of towels I did seemed a bit "fluffier". Anyone else tried them? Thoughts?

PS - I never, every use dryer sheets but I do use liquid softener in most other loads (other than towels, jeans, etc.).
